Tehran, YJC. -- On 22 September 2013, the seminar of Iran Steel Market, Benefits, Challenges and Perspectives was held in the economics faculty of Allameh Tabatabaiee University with planning and collaboration of Iran Mercantile Exchange and Metal Bulletin with the target of familiarizing the active brokers, market participants and academics focusing on different aspects of steel industries such as production cycle, steel trade solutions.
According to the report from IME international affairs and PR, this seminar was highly welcomed by active brokers, market participants and academics. Iron ore, Iran steel production capacity, production of concentrate, pig iron ore, crude steel production and development plans for acquiring a better production capacity and quality were the most important topics in this seminar.

Metal Bulletin was first introduced in 1913. Its mission then, as it is now, was to provide must-have timely information, including price indications, for the global non-ferrous metals and steel markets. Over the years, Metal Bulletin became established as the bible for the world's metals and steel trading communities.

Iran Mercantile Exchange is the premium venue for each single part of steel industry and whoever involves in this business that can enjoy from securing the offering, supply and financing the trades in both local and export trades. Iron ore, re-bar, i-beam, billet are the main products which are desirable for local producers and buyers of both local and international markets. IME trade statistics, in metals and minerals shows that this trading ring activities form the lion share of the total market for this exchange regarding both in value and volume.
